For over 30 years one man was my best friend, partner, chief encourager and gentle critic. Anyone who has enjoyed my work owes him a debt for never doubting me, selflessly plodding around archaeological sites and museums, reading manuscripts, suggesting changes and proudly supporting me in public and private. Donations in his memory will go to researching kidney cancer. Ground-breaking surgery gave us three wonderful extra years, and what was learned from this brave and tenacious patient may go on to help others.
